Managing End-of-Life Finances
Planning for final expenses can feel overwhelming, especially if you're on a limited income. Nevertheless, there are numerous options available to match every financial situation. A traditional funeral may seem like the only choice, but think about more cost-effective alternatives like cremation or a direct burial.
Prepaying for your final expenses can alleviate the burden on your loved ones. You can choose from a range of plans, featuring preneed funeral contracts and life insurance policies with death benefits specifically designed to cover end-of-life costs.
Regardless your financial standing, it's important to carefully plan for final expenses. By exploring your options and creating a well-structured plan, you can provide that your wishes are honored and your family is secured.
